Culinary Uses of Bella

In India, Bella is used in various culinary dishes. The pulp of the fruit is often used to make refreshing drinks. These drinks are popular during the hot summer months. Bella can also be used in jams and chutneys. Its unique flavour adds a distinct taste to these dishes.

Traditional Uses of Bella

Bella has been used in traditional Indian medicine for many years. It is believed to have healing properties and is often used to treat various ailments. The fruit is considered sacred in some Indian cultures and is used in religious rituals. Its leaves are also used in worship practices.

Growing Regions of Bella in India

Bella grows well in dry climates and can be found across India. It thrives in regions with hot temperatures and low rainfall. States like Uttar Pradesh, Bihar, and Madhya Pradesh are known for cultivating this fruit. Farmers often grow Bella alongside other crops due to its hardy nature.
